How The Wolfman scares

The Wolfman leans on gothic atmosphere, fog-soaked moors, and a doomed family curse before letting loose with bursts of brutal, physical violence. It's more about the shock of sudden claws and teeth than lingering dread, with transformation scenes and attacks that hit hard and fast. The blood and mauling are shown pretty openly, so it plays more like a monster movie than a mind-bender. Good for fans of classic creature horror who want gothic mood mixed with real physical carnage rather than slow psychological unease.

How scary is The Wolfman?

On The Horror Database's 0–5 intensity scale, The Wolfman rates 3/5 — solidly scary, balancing creeping dread with well-placed shocks. It attacks the body more than the mind — physical, in-your-face horror. Expect it to be heavy on gore and fun-first. Some of it will follow you to bed, but it lets go within a day or so.
